Analysis
The most recent figure for agriculture, forestry, and fishing, value added (current lcu), per in Somalia is 1,058 current LCU per US$ of GDP, measured in 1990. That is the highest value across all 31 years on record.
That represents a change of up 267.6% on the previous year and up 5,600.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, agriculture, forestry, and fishing, value added (current lcu), per in Somalia peaked at 1,058 current LCU per US$ of GDP in 1990 and was at its lowest, 1.97 current LCU per US$ of GDP, in 1974.
That places Somalia 9th out of 206 countries with data for 1990, putting it in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Agriculture, forestry, and fishing, value added (current LCU)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Agriculture, forestry, and fishing, value added (current LCU) ÷ GDP (current US$)
Computed from
- Agriculture, forestry, and fishing, value added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
- GDP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
